ChatGPT
Among the free options, ChatGPT emerges as a leading contender, utilizing GPT-4o technology to produce images comparable to those created by OpenAI’s DALL-E. This tool can generate visuals in various styles, from hyperrealistic to artistic.

The image generation feature is seamlessly integrated into the ChatGPT interface on all platforms, where users can simply input a text prompt to request visuals. Moreover, users can refine elements through multiple prompts. ChatGPT’s image generation tool notably sparked the Ghibli trend in AI art.

Google Gemini
Google’s Gemini presents another impressive free AI image generator, similar to ChatGPT and driven by the Imagen 3 AI model. It allows users to create images for various applications, from marketing materials to stock images for essays and projects.

In tests, Gemini excelled in rendering text within images when compared to ChatGPT. However, to achieve optimal results, users must provide detailed prompts; vague descriptions may yield unsatisfactory outcomes.

Adobe Firefly
Adobe’s image generation feature, previously exclusive to paid subscribers, is now accessible through the Adobe Firefly app, which offers free monthly credits for image creation and other AI functionalities. This tool, utilizing Adobe’s Firefly AI models, generates high-quality images across various styles and textures. It’s effective for both image creation and text rendering.

In comparison to ChatGPT and Gemini, Adobe’s offering is more polished and excels in realistic outputs. Additionally, it generates four unique options for each request, providing greater variety for users.
How to Generate AI Images on Adobe Firefly App
To get started, download the Adobe Firefly app on either Android or iOS. After signing in, you will see the option for image generation at the top of the homepage. Simply enter your prompt and click the Generate button.
Ideogram
For users seeking a distinctive approach to AI image generation, Ideogram is a compelling option. Although primarily a paid platform, it offers free credits for image creation. Ideogram provides advanced tools for customizing aspect ratios, selecting predefined styles, and choosing specific color palettes.

Our experience revealed that Ideogram’s customization features are particularly beneficial. Users who prefer not to specify technical details can easily select options from a dropdown menu.

Qwen
Qwen introduces a new model for image generation, making it a versatile tool. This model supports multilingual input, accepting prompts in various languages, including English and Chinese. Additionally, users can upload images for editing using natural language commands.

Testing showed that Qwen’s image editing features are particularly useful. Although inline edits aren’t possible, users can specify changes by issuing natural language requests. The platform is entirely free, adding to its appeal.
How to Generate AI Images on Qwen
Access the chatbot here. Set the model to Qwen3-235B-A22B using the model picker located at the top left. From there, input your text prompt, and the AI will respond to your requests.
